Đánh giá các thành phần bền vững xã hội trong lĩnh vực nông nghiệp của Iran bằng cách tiếp cận hệ thống
Tóm tắt
Nghiên cứu mô tả tương quan hiện tại tập trung vào việc đánh giá tính bền vững xã hội của các hệ thống nông nghiệp gia đình dựa trên trồng xen và các hệ thống hợp tác xã nông nghiệp với cách tiếp cận hệ thống. Dân số thống kê được cấu thành từ các làng tại huyện Shiraz thuộc tỉnh Fars, Iran, những nơi tham gia vào hệ thống trồng xen và sản xuất hợp tác xã. Ở bước đầu tiên, 186 nông dân đang sử dụng hệ thống nông nghiệp gia đình dựa trên trồng xen được chọn bằng cách đếm số liệu. Ở bước thứ hai, 200 thành viên của các hợp tác xã nông nghiệp trong huyện này được chọn mẫu bằng kỹ thuật chọn ngẫu nhiên phân tầng với phân bổ tỷ lệ. Công cụ nghiên cứu là một bảng hỏi tự thiết kế, và dữ liệu được phân tích bằng phần mềm SPSS22. Các kết quả cho thấy các thành phần tồn tại và hiệu quả được gán trọng số cao nhất trong các hệ thống nông nghiệp gia đình, trong khi các thành phần sự đồng tồn tại và khả năng thích ứng được gán trọng số cao nhất trong các hệ thống hợp tác xã. Kết quả của việc đánh giá theo mô hình Morris cho thấy không có thành phần nào về sự bền vững xã hội đạt ở mức độ bền vững. Kết quả phân tích phân biệt các đặc điểm của nông dân về mức độ bền vững xã hội cho thấy chín thành phần có thể giải thích mức độ bền vững xã hội: trình độ học vấn, sự đồng tồn tại, quy mô gia đình, thu nhập, tự do hành động, sự tồn tại, sự bình đẳng, trách nhiệm và hiệu quả.
